Ideal Therapy For OCD
The most effective treatment for OCD is cognitive behavioral therapy (CBT), including exposure and action avoidance (ERP). Other treatments include a sort of antidepressant called clomipramine, and deep mind stimulation.
ERP involves revealing yourself to anxiety-provoking thoughts and standing up to uncontrollable rituals. It aids you discover to tolerate fear and anxiousness, which decreases OCD symptoms.
Cognitive behavior modification
For lots of people with OCD, the first step in therapy is psychotherapy or talk treatment Usually this includes cognitive behavior modification (CBT) which is a scientifically-based technique to change harmful thoughts and actions. CBT may consist of direct exposure and response prevention (ERP) or other strategies such as mindfulness and acceptance and dedication therapy (ACT). Make certain your therapist is learnt these techniques, particularly ERP for OCD.
ERP is when you are subjected to a been afraid object or scenario, such as dust, while standing up to the urge to do a compulsive routine, such as washing. Gradually, the hope is that your anxiety will certainly reduce and you can quit engaging in the uncontrollable behavior. Along with CBT, certain psychiatric medications can also aid control OCD. These are typically called SSRIs or antidepressants and can be suggested by your therapist. Taking medicine in mix with psychotherapy assists about 70% of people with OCD. Exposure and feedback prevention treatment
For individuals with OCD, fixations create stress and anxiety that they can not control. This stress and anxiety brings about compulsions, which are ritualistic habits that they really feel compelled to carry out in order to reduce the tension. Some typical obsessions consist of examining that they haven't done damage to others, cleaning, and pondering.
Cognitive behavioral therapy (CBT) is an efficient therapy for OCD, with or without drug. CBT focuses on determining and changing undesirable idea patterns that might be adding to symptoms. One of the most popular treatments for OCD is exposure and reaction avoidance treatment, or ERP. This therapy involves slowly revealing yourself to things that trigger your compulsive ideas, and then resisting the urge to do compulsions. This is performed in a risk-free setting, either in the therapist's office or in dual diagnosis treatment programs real life.
The goal of exposure and action avoidance is to show your mind that you won't be harmed if you do not do your compulsions. Your specialist will certainly never ever ask you to do anything that would certainly be dangerous or break your worths.

Cognitive behavior modification (CBT) is among the first-line therapies for OCD. It shows individuals to recognize the wrong messages that their mind sends them. With advice from a licensed therapist, they can learn to change these negative patterns of thinking.
Psychological medications can also help with OCD signs and symptoms. They are most effective when absorbed combination with CBT or ERP treatment. Commonly, antidepressants are one of the most typical. These consist of fluoxetine (Prozac) and sertraline (Zoloft).
